Learning Outcomes
Upon successful completion of the course, students are expected to:
- understand the concept of empathy
- delve into the methodology of the motivational interviewing
- practice the use of communication skills useful in dealing with challenging situations in the health sector
Course Content (Syllabus)
- Introduction to the Calgary-Cambridge method of medical history taking
- Role-playing
- Demanding situations in communication: The difficult patient
- Announcing unpleasant news
- Balint groups
- Developing empathy skills using film media - The power of storytelling
